PEGO-PEREZ, Emilio Rubén. Second intention healing of a wound: stimulation of the epithelial borders with vitamin E acetate spray. Gerokomos [online]. 2023, vol.34, n.2, pp.150-153. Epub 23-Oct-2023. ISSN 1134-928X.
At present, the care of wounds that must heal by secondary intention is carried out in a humid environment and using the TIME strategy, the people who suffer from them suffer a decrease in quality of life. The objective of this work is to present an approach and management of the epithelial border with nebulized vitamin E acetate. The case deals with a 74-year-old patient with type 2 diabetes mellitus who presented a wound on the front of his left leg. The main nursing diagnosis has been tissue integrity. As main results, the hydration of the peri-lesion edges and the reduction in the size of the wound have been established. In conclusion, vitamin E acetate has allowed the conservation and improvement of the state of the peri-injury tissue and of the newly formed tissue, as well as the saving of exposure times of the injury to the environment.
